Araucanía Games 2022: La Pampa added gold medals in judo and swimming

This Thursday was a day with many victories for La Pampa in the different disciplines that compete in the 2022 Araucanía Games. In the afternoon, women’s judo won the gold medal at the hands of Sasha Biondo.

An immense joy for her and for the Province. Sasha, after the fight, expressed her extreme satisfaction, since she reached the final stages and this time she was victorious.

“Many sensations, I achieved what I wanted and finally we beat Chile. I always reach the final and I never get it. I was preparing for the South American and I couldn’t go. I prepared myself with everything, I had a strong rival but I took the victory,” said the athlete from Pampas.

This gold medal was specially dedicated to his family for all the support and to the Undersecretary of Sports of La Pampa.

FEMALE AND MEN’S SOCCER

The women’s soccer team from La Pampa faced Río Negro, at the Schilling stadium in the Comuna de Osorno. The pampeans sold a strong rival, with a goal from Melanie Gramajo.

The women’s soccer delegate, Marcela Castro, stated that the girls “are rude.” “All of us from the pampas have to be proud, after a very hot game, they had to stop to hydrate since the synthetic is also hotter,” he said.

Meanwhile, men’s soccer won by a landslide, 7-0 against its rival Magallanes.

MALE AND FEMALE VOLLEYBALL

Women’s volleyball defeated Chubut 3-1 in the morning, and defeated Santa Cruz by the same result.

In men’s volleyball they defeated Santa Cruz and Tierra del Fuego.

Women’s Basketball lost against Río Negro 48-52 and won against Santa Cruz 59-53.

And men’s basketball beat Neuquén 80-42.

SWIMMING MEDALS

This Thursday was very favorable for La Pampa, since in swimming they won two gold medals: one for Bruno Barzola in the 200-meter medley and another for José Gramajo in the 1,500-meter crawl. He also added a silver medal with Martina Souto in the 800-meter crawl and another from Sofía Gazan in the 50-meter freestyle.
